Energy Efficiency

Energy is vital but also expensive. What’s more, the world has been misusing its energy at a great financial cost and at a cost to Mother Earth. However, buildings can now become energy efficient thanks to intelligent HVAC systems. The best air conditioner on the market should be energy efficient.

Smart HVAC systems are programmed to monitor their surroundings and make the necessary adjustments. This means that buildings will now utilize just as much energy they need especially when it comes to heating. Consequently, this will save buildings owners a lot of money and help make the world greener.

Improved Comfort and Functionality

Buildings would be very uncomfortable without HVAC systems – they keep out the cold in winter, regulate the blistering heat during summer, and ensure supply of clean air. Today, smart best air conditioner do this without much supervision. They monitor the conditions of the surroundings and regulate factors such as temperature and air conditioning.

Smart HVAC systems are also easier to maintain, so you don’t have to deal with snags that temporarily leave you in discomfort. Fully developed intelligent HVAC systems are capable of monitoring their different components and determine which ones need maintenance. In addition to ensuring uninterrupted functionality and comfort, this also helps to save money that would have been used to fix greater problems in case of a breakdown.

Making Your HVAC System Smart

HVAC systems became “smart” with the development of smart thermostats. Today, however, more components are smart, and they go a long way in improving the functionality of your HVAC system. If you are yet to upgrade your HVAC, then you have two options: get a new smart one installed or replace just the important components – the latter is always more popular in terms of costs.

A smart thermostat should be the first place to begin. The most basic smart thermostat will accurately measure the building’s temperature. However, advanced thermostats can read humidity, temperature, and occupancy, among other factors. The thermostat then uses this data to adjust the room’s conditions and improve comfort. However, it is always advisable to have an auditor analyze the room and determine whether latent heat may have anything to do with discomfort.

The next step should be to install environmental sensor technology. These sensors complement the smart thermostat’s capabilities and make virtually every component of the system smart including the ducts. However, ensure that the sensors are compatible with your HVAC system as issues of compatibility have been raised. You can do it yourself, but it is advisable to consult a professional technician for surety.
